Understanding Console-Specific Gaming Headsets
Console-specific gaming headsets are designed to optimize audio performance for various gaming platforms, ensuring that players can experience the best sound while enjoying their favorite games. Here’s how these headsets stand out:
3D Sound Features: Provides an immersive audio experience by simulating surround sound, allowing gamers to pinpoint sounds from different directions.
Noise Isolation Technology: Minimizes external distractions, enabling gamers to focus entirely on the game, leading to improved performance.
Instant Compatibility: Many headsets offer seamless connections with multiple consoles, meaning less setup time and more gaming time.
Enhanced Voice Clarity: Built-in microphones designed for gaming can enhance communication with teammates while minimizing background noise.
Durability and Comfort: Crafted for long hours of use, these headsets are made with ergonomic designs and quality materials for comfort and longevity.
Audio Customization: Many headsets feature adjustable sound profiles, allowing users to tailor the audio experience to their preferences.
Frequently Asked Questions
Which headset should I buy for PS5 gaming sessions?
For PS5, choose the SteelSeries Arctis Nova Pro Wireless for PS5: it has an average rating of 4.8, active noise cancellation, and a dual-battery system to avoid interruptions during longer play sessions.
Does the Razer Kaira Pro for PS5 support 3D audio?
Yes—the Razer Kaira Pro for PlayStation 5 includes immersive 3D audio, plus cooling gel ear cushions and customizable EQ settings, with an average rating of 4.5.

Which Turtle Beach Stealth 700 Gen 2 MAX supports Xbox?
The Turtle Beach Stealth 700 Gen 2 MAX for Xbox is designed for Xbox and features long battery life, Bluetooth connection, and crystal clear communication, with an average rating of 4.7.
